These days Comic Con is more about the movies coming up than about the comics. Yes there are a lot of comic booths but what draws the crowds is normally the booths for various movies and tv shows.

JJ Has a LONG history with Comic Con, heck I believe they had a booth for LOST and a panel every year the show was on. I also remember there was some info about Cloverfield before it came out.

Don't let the name fool you. Comic Con is more Entertainment Con. Ask anyone in the Comic business... you get more Comic stuff at Wizards World. (just avoid Wizards New York, last years sucked)

It has nothing to do with SUPER 8 not being related to comics.

Yes, JJ is appearing in the panel with Whedon, but they're speaking at the Entertainment Weekly panel on the subject of pop culture entertainment. EW may sneak in a SUPER 8 question, but I doubt JJ can or will say much about it this early. EW has their own panel agenda on this one.

To fully promote SUPER 8, JJ would need to be in a Paramount-sponsored panel with the studio behind it (bringing film clips, photos, etc.).

I'm guessing you'll have to watch for WonderCon or some other event in the next 9 months to see a true SUPER 8 panel at a con. I'd guess SUPER 8 will hit theaters before Comic-Con 2011.
